In a major setback to the INDIA alliance ahead of the Lok Sabha elections, former Maharashtra Chief Minister Ashok Chavan resigned from Congress on February 12.
According to a News 18 report, Chavan was unhappy with the party and is likely to join BJP in the coming days.
This comes as yet another blow to the Opposition after the split in Shiv Sena and NCP and the fall of Maha Vikas Aghadi government in the state.
